General Machining Capabilities
| Parameter | Standard Capability |
|---|---|
| Supported Production Volume | 1–10,000+ parts |
| Prototype Quantity | 1–20 parts |
| Low-Volume Production | 20–500 parts |
| Batch Production | 500–10,000+ parts |
| Standard Dimensional Tolerance | ±0.010 mm |
| Precision Dimensional Tolerance | ±0.005 mm |
| Standard Angular Tolerance | ±0.5° |
| Precision Angular Tolerance | ±0.1° |
| Position Tolerance | Down to 0.010 mm |
| Flatness | Down to 0.005 mm |
| Concentricity | Down to 0.008 mm |
| Standard Surface Finish | Ra 1.6 μm |
| Precision Machined Finish | Ra 0.8 μm |
| Ground Surface Finish | Down to Ra 0.2 μm |
| EDM Surface Finish | Down to Ra 0.8 μm |
| Minimum Wall Thickness | 0.5 mm |
| Minimum Machined Hole Diameter | Ø0.5 mm |
| Minimum Thread Size | M1.0 |
| Maximum Part Weight | 1,000 kg |
| Standard Lead Time | 10–20 business days |
| Prototype Lead Time | 5–10 business days |
| Expedited Service | Available |
| Minimum Order Quantity | 1 part |
CNC Milling
- 3-axis, 4-axis and 5-axis CNC milling
- Max 3-Axis Part Size: 1,000 × 600 × 600 mm
- Max 4-Axis Part Size: Ø500 × 800 mm
- Max 5-Axis Part Size: Ø500 × 400 mm
- Max Table Load: 800 kg
- Positioning Accuracy: ±0.005 mm
- Repeatability: ±0.003 mm
- Min Internal Corner Radius: R0.3 mm
- Operations: Facing, contouring, pocketing, drilling, tapping, boring, thread milling
- Suitable Parts: Housings, brackets, manifolds, impellers, blades, plates, complex structural components
CNC Turning & Mill-Turn
- 2-axis CNC turning and live-tool turning
- Max Turning Diameter: Ø500 mm
- Max Turning Length: 1,000 mm
- Max Machining Diameter (Mill-Turn): Ø400 mm
- Max Machining Length (Mill-Turn): 800 mm
- Turning Tolerance: Down to ±0.005 mm
- Concentricity: Down to 0.008 mm
- Roundness: Down to 0.005 mm
- Operations: Turning, milling, drilling, tapping, boring, grooving, off-center machining
- Suitable Parts: Shafts, sleeves, bushings, pins, nozzles, fittings, valve parts, threaded components
Swiss CNC Turning, Wire EDM & Sinker EDM
- Swiss CNC Turning: Ø32 mm bar, up to 7 axes, down to Ø0.5 mm
- Wire EDM: 600 × 400 × 300 mm, ±0.005 mm accuracy, Ra 0.8 μm
- Sinker EDM: 500 × 350 × 300 mm, Ra 0.4 μm, R0.05 mm internal corners
Precision Grinding
- Surface, cylindrical and centerless grinding
- Tolerance: Down to ±0.002 mm
- Surface Finish: Down to Ra 0.2 μm
